I don't know about the newer bikes but Triumph always used to have maps for open cans they would put on your bike for not a great deal, it was £12 last time but that was years ago.
Failing that do it yourself.
You need a laptop.
A cable like this.
https://www.amazon.co.uk/OBD2-OBD-II-Cable-409-1-Skoda/dp/B001C1MNTM/ref=sr_1_2?ie=UTF8&qid=1412687294&sr=8-2&keywords=vagcom
This Software.

Worth noting that certain bikes have a system that lets fresh air into the exhaust port for a cleaner burn.
